Specialists
Watchlist
Ratings
Toa Stappard
Directing
1998
[
]
Strip
(Director)
2004
[
]
Euston Road
(Director)
[
]
Stories of Lost Souls
(Director)
2016
[
]
Goalie
(Director)
2022
[
]
Taumanu
(Director)
2025
[
]
Mārama
(Director)
Writing
2025
[
]
Mārama
(Writer)
💀
credits.md